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for the reporting period was ¥122,249,995.26, a decrease of 36.96% compared to the same period last year [26]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was ¥66,655,827.97, representing a significant increase of 426.36% year-on-year [26]. - The basic earnings per share increased to ¥0.0935, up 425.78% from a loss of ¥0.0287 in the previous year [26]. - The total assets at the end of the reporting period were ¥881,169,202.16, reflecting a decrease of 5.60% compared to the end of the previous year [26]. - The company's total revenue for the reporting period was ¥122,249,995.26, representing a decrease of 36.96% compared to ¥193,934,024.83 in the same period last year [50]. - The revenue from self-owned brand apparel was ¥76,469,186.47, accounting for 62.55% of total revenue, down 35.22% year-on-year [51]. - The revenue from agency brand apparel was ¥31,492,133.63, which is 25.76% of total revenue, showing a decline of 42.22% compared to the previous year [51]. - The company's total sales expenses decreased by 25.84% to CNY 70,867,637.77, primarily due to reduced advertising and store renovation costs [61]. - The company reported a significant decline in operating cash flow, down 99.28% to ¥721,750.06, compared to ¥100,041,105.14 in the previous year [50]. - The company reported a net loss of 23,713,594.15 yuan due to inventory impairment provisions, accounting for -35.75% of total profit [71]. Risks and Challenges - The company reported a significant financial challenge, with a warning issued by the accounting firm regarding the audit opinion for the 2021 financial statements, which remains unresolved [4]. - The stock has been under risk warning since January 13, 2020, due to the controlling shareholder's violation of regulations, with the stock name changed to "ST Modern" and a trading limit of 5% [8]. - The company faced an administrative penalty of 400,000 yuan due to violations related to information disclosure, as per the decision from the China Securities Regulatory Commission [9]. - The company is exposed to macroeconomic fluctuations, which could impact its profitability due to economic slowdowns and consumer spending declines [10]. - Increased competition in the retail sector poses a risk to the company's profitability as it transitions to a new retail platform [11]. - Currency exchange rate fluctuations present a risk to the company's operations and earnings due to its international business dealings [12]. - The company has not provided specific future performance guidance or projections, emphasizing the need for investors to remain cautious [5]. - The management has outlined potential risks and corresponding measures in the report, highlighting the importance of risk awareness for investors [5]. - The company faces risks from intensified industry competition, particularly in the new retail sector, and plans to expand online sales channels and enhance product design and marketing strategies [89]. - The company is exposed to inventory management risks due to high inventory levels and low turnover rates, necessitating careful management to avoid potential write-downs [90]. - The company has been subject to foreign exchange risk due to international operations and transactions, which may impact its financial performance [91]. Investments and Assets - The company invested ¥240 million in Nanjing Jiayuan New Energy Co., holding a 16.70% stake, but faced difficulties in obtaining necessary documentation from the investee [27]. - The fair value of the investment in Nanjing Jiayuan was assessed at ¥81,546,100, indicating an impairment of ¥158,453,900, with a reduction rate of 66.02% [28]. - The company's cash and cash equivalents decreased by 91.21% to -¥12,949,313.28, influenced by cash flows from operating, investing, and financing activities [50]. - The company has established long-term stable partnerships with high-end department stores and shopping centers, enhancing its brand image and customer trust [44]. - The company has expanded its online sales channels, including new stores on Douyin, to adapt to changing consumer habits [46]. - The company has secured authorizations from numerous international brands, including SAINT LAURENT PARIS and BALENCIAGA, strengthening its market position [43].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for the first half of 2023 was ¥157,347,602.08, representing an increase of 28.71% compared to ¥122,249,995.26 in the same period last year[26]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ders of the listed company was -¥39,132,818.05, a decrease of 158.71% from ¥66,655,827.97 in the previous year[26]. - The net cash flow from operating activities was ¥33,821,266.58, a significant increase of 4,586.01% compared to ¥721,750.06 in the same period last year[26]. - The total assets at the end of the reporting period were ¥693,765,249.99, down 12.22% from ¥790,328,074.33 at the end of the previous year[26]. - The net assets attributable to shareholders of the listed company decreased by 6.81% to ¥471,411,435.32 from ¥505,859,010.23 at the end of the previous year[26]. - The basic earnings per share were -¥0.0549, a decline of 158.72% from ¥0.0935 in the same period last year[26]. - The weighted average return on net assets was -8.03%, a decrease of 16.54% from 8.51% in the previous year[26]. - The company's gross profit margin for offline retail was 70.30%, an increase of 3.57% year-on-year, with revenue from offline retail reaching ¥149,138,752.18, up 32.37% from the previous year[51]. - The company's management expenses rose by 39.78% to ¥26,327,255.76, primarily due to increased consulting fees[48]. - The total operating costs for the first half of 2023 were CNY 153.86 million, an increase of 17.88% compared to CNY 130.51 million in the same period of 2022[188]. Business Strategy and Operations - The company emphasizes outsourcing for production and logistics, ensuring product quality while reaching a broader consumer base through a combination of direct sales and franchise models[38]. - The company has established long-term stable partnerships with international brands, leveraging its understanding of global fashion trends to introduce emerging brands to the Chinese market[40]. - The company’s business model includes a focus on design and brand promotion, while production is managed by specialized factories and suppliers[38]. - The company has expanded its online sales channels, adding a new store on Xiaohongshu during the reporting period, enhancing consumer touchpoints[44]. - The company operates a total of 80 direct-operated stores with a total area of 14,191.93 square meters and an average store efficiency of 1.707 million yuan[53]. - The company has established an online store on Xiaohongshu for its brand CANUDILO, which opened on June 6, 2023[62]. - The company plans to enhance offline operations and customer engagement to improve sales performance amid declining consumer confidence[67]. - The company aims to attract high-quality young consumers through various promotional activities, including coffee tasting events and collaborations[67]. 〔2023〕101 号 关于对摩登大道时尚集团股份有限公司、林毅 超采取出具警示函措施的决定 摩登大道时尚集团股份有限公司、林毅超: 经查,你公司存在以下信息披露违规行为: 2023 年 1 月 31 日,你公司披露《2022 年年度业绩预告》, 预计公司 2022 年归属于上市公司股东的净利润(以下简称净 利润)为亏损 1,680 万元至 1,120 万元。6 月 30 日,你公司披 露 2022 年年度报告,2022 年经审计净利润为亏损 4,140.12 万元,与此前的业绩预告存在重大差异。上述情形违反了《上市公 司信息披露管理办法》(证监会令第 182 号)第三条的规定。 根据《上市公司信息披露管理办法》(证监会令第 182 号) 第五十二条的规定,我局决定对你们采取出具警示函的行政监 管措施,你们应认真吸取教训,切实加强对证券法律法规的学 习,依法真实、准确、完整、及时、公平地履行信息披露义务。同 时你公司应对相关责任人员进行内部问责,于收到本决定书 30 日内向我局报送整改报告、内部问责情况,并抄报深圳证券交易 所。 如果对本监督管理措施不服,可以在收到本决定书之日起 60 日内向中国证券监督管理 ...
